Understanding the Mechanics Behind the Games

It’s tempting to think of online casino games as mere digital versions of their brick-and-mortar counterparts, but the truth is far more nuanced. Random Number Generators (RNGs) dictate outcomes, ensuring that each spin or card dealt is as unpredictable as a poker face at a high-stakes table. However, not all RNGs are created equal, and some platforms might lean more towards the house edge than the player’s fortune. This subtle bias can turn a seemingly fair game into a slow drain on your bankroll, much like a slot machine that’s just shy of paying out.

Bonuses: Bait or Genuine Opportunity?

Bonuses in online casinos often resemble a magician’s flourish—dazzling at first glance but hiding the catch beneath the hat. Welcome bonuses, free spins, and reload offers can seem like a golden ticket, yet the fine print usually tells a different story. Wagering requirements and game restrictions can turn a tempting bonus into a complex puzzle that’s more frustrating than rewarding. It’s a bit like being promised a jackpot but having to solve a Rubik’s Cube blindfolded to claim it.

  • Check wagering requirements carefully—high multiples can be a red flag.
  • Look for bonuses with clear, straightforward terms.
  • Beware of bonuses that exclude popular games or have short expiration periods.
  • Consider whether the bonus aligns with your playing style and bankroll.

Payment Methods: Convenience or Complication?

Depositing and withdrawing funds should be as smooth as a well-oiled roulette wheel, but often it’s more like trying to cash in chips at a dodgy backroom game. Some casinos offer a dizzying array of payment options, from credit cards to e-wallets and cryptocurrencies, but the speed and reliability of these methods vary wildly. Withdrawal times can stretch from hours to weeks, and fees might sneak in like an unwelcome pit boss. Always scrutinize the payment terms before committing your cash to the table.

Comparison of Common Payment Methods in Online Casinos
Payment Method Typical Deposit Time Typical Withdrawal Time Common Fees Notes
Credit/Debit Card Instant 2-5 Business Days Usually None Widely accepted, but some banks block gambling transactions
E-Wallets (PayPal, Skrill) Instant Within 24 Hours Sometimes small fees Fastest withdrawals, popular among frequent players
Bank Transfer 1-3 Business Days 3-7 Business Days Possible fees Reliable but slow, less convenient for casual players
Cryptocurrency Minutes to Hours Minutes to Hours Variable network fees Increasingly popular, but volatile and less regulated
